Axonal brain injury that is diffuse
Diffuse axonal brain injury is the most prevalent kind of brain injury. They occur by a head injury that occurs hard and suddenly. These injuries can lead to serious issues.
DAI can cause permanent disability, and possibly death. It is essential to receive appropriate medical attention due to the long-term consequences.
To diagnose and treat a patient, a multidisciplinary team of doctors might be employed. The team could comprise physical therapists, occupational therapists, and counselors.
Brain imaging is utilized in the majority of cases to diagnose the condition. This includes CT scans as well as MRIs. Both methods make use of radio waves to produce images of the brain. They are not always able to produce accurate results.
Evoked Potentials, also known as VEP or SSEP, are an additional test that can be conducted. They test the electrical activity of the brain and visual and auditory pathways.
Blunt force impacts can result in an axonal brain injury that is diffuse however the most frequent cause is a high-impact auto accident. The brain is able to move rapidly inside the skull when it is struck. The blood vessels tear in this process and cause bruising. The delicate white matter of the brain is also torn.
Axonal injuries that are severe and diffuse can result in coma. Depending on the severity and duration of the injury, the patient could remain vegetative for days, weeks or months.
Survivors of diffuse axonal injuries may also suffer from cognitive impairments and memory loss. Moreover, the right part of the brain could be damaged, causing issues with speech, memory, and visual-spatial capabilities.

Whiplash injuries
Whiplash is a type of injury that affects the ligaments, muscles and soft tissues of the neck. It can be caused by the sudden stopping or collision.
The pain is most commonly felt in the neck and upper back. It may also affect the arms, shoulders, and other parts of your body. The patient may also experience headaches and ringing ears.
